Sistem pengelolaan basis data, atau Database Management System (DBMS), telah menjadi tulang punggung bagi banyak bisnis dan organisasi dalam mengelola data. DBMS merupakan alat yang kuat yang dapat membantu dalam pengolahan dan penyimpanan data, yang pada gilirannya memungkinkan perusahaan untuk mengambil keputusan yang lebih baik.
Namun, seperti halnya hal lainnya, DBMS juga memiliki kelebihan dan kekurangan yang perlu dipertimbangkan sebelum mengimplementasikannya. Dalam artikel ini, kami akan menguraikan apa yang dimaksud dengan DBMS, fungsi DBMS, membahas kelebihan dan kekurangannya, serta memberikan contoh penerapannya.
Apa yang Dimaksud dengan Database Management System (DBMS)?
DBMS, atau Database Management System, adalah perangkat lunak yang digunakan untuk mengelola, mengatur, dan menyimpan data dalam suatu basis data. Pada konteks ini, basis data yang dimaksudkan merujuk pada koleksi data yang tersimpan secara terstruktur dalam satu lokasi, sehingga dapat diakses dan dikelola dengan mudah.
DBMS memiliki fungsi utama sebagai perantara antara pengguna dan database, memungkinkan pengguna untuk mengakses, menambahkan, mengubah, dan menghapus data dengan mudah.
Apa Saja Fungsi DBMS?
DBMS memiliki beberapa fungsi utama, yaitu:
- Pendefinisian data: DBMS memungkinkan pengguna untuk mendefinisikan struktur data, termasuk tabel, relasi, dan batasan.
- Penyimpanan data: DBMS menyimpan data dengan cara yang teratur sehingga mudah diakses dan dicari.
- Manipulasi data: Pengguna dapat menambahkan, mengubah, dan menghapus data dengan mudah melalui DBMS.
- Akses data: DBMS memastikan bahwa data dapat diakses oleh banyak pengguna secara bersamaan tanpa konflik.
- Pemeliharaan data: DBMS juga bertanggung jawab atas pemeliharaan data, termasuk backup, pemulihan, dan keamanan.
Baca juga: 7 Keuntungan Database Management System buat Bisnis
5 Kelebihan DBMS
Database Management System (DBMS) adalah alat yang sangat berharga dalam pengelolaan data bisnis. Berikut adalah beberapa kelebihan utama dari DBMS:
1. Meningkatkan Efisiensi
Salah satu kelebihan utama DBMS adalah kemampuannya untuk meningkatkan efisiensi operasional. Ini terjadi karena DBMS memungkinkan data untuk disimpan dalam satu lokasi yang teratur, sehingga mengurangi duplikasi data.
Penyimpanan data dalam basis data yang terpusat memungkinkan perusahaan dapat menghindari masalah seperti kehilangan data dan kesulitan dalam mengakses informasi yang relevan.
2. Memudahkan Pengolahan Data
DBMS memiliki kemampuan untuk mengolah data dengan cara yang lebih canggih. Ini termasuk kemampuan untuk menggabungkan data dari berbagai sumber, melakukan operasi matematika dan statistik, serta menerapkan aturan bisnis yang kompleks.
Alat-alat ini memungkinkan perusahaan dapat melakukan analisis data yang lebih mendalam dan mengambil keputusan yang lebih baik.
3. Menjaga Keamanan Data
Keamanan data adalah aspek yang sangat penting dalam dunia bisnis, dan DBMS memberikan perlindungan yang kuat. DBMS memungkinkan perusahaan untuk mengontrol siapa yang dapat mengakses data dan apa yang dapat mereka lakukan. Ini berarti bahwa data sensitif hanya dapat diakses oleh pihak yang berwenang.
4. Memungkinkan Akses Data secara Bersamaan
Salah satu kelebihan besar DBMS adalah kemampuannya untuk mendukung akses data secara bersamaan oleh banyak pengguna. Hal ini memungkinkan berbagai departemen dan individu dalam perusahaan untuk mengakses data yang sama secara bersamaan tanpa konflik.
5. Memudahkan Integrasi Data
DBMS memfasilitasi integrasi data dari berbagai sumber. Ini adalah kelebihan penting terutama untuk perusahaan yang memiliki banyak sistem dan platform yang berbeda. DBMS memungkinkan data dari sistem yang berbeda untuk digabungkan, diproses, dan dianalisis bersama-sama.
Baca juga: Pengenalan Database-as-a-Service (DBaaS): Definisi dan Konsep
5 Kekurangan DBMS
Meskipun DBMS memiliki banyak kelebihan, ada juga beberapa kekurangan yang perlu diperhatikan, yaitu:
1. Biaya yang Mahal
Implementasi dan pengelolaan DBMS seringkali memerlukan investasi yang signifikan. Biaya meliputi perangkat keras yang kuat, lisensi perangkat lunak, pelatihan staf, dan pemeliharaan rutin. Ini bisa menjadi hambatan, terutama bagi bisnis kecil dengan anggaran terbatas.
2. Memerlukan Keahlian Khusus
Pengelolaan DBMS memerlukan keahlian khusus. Perusahaan perlu memiliki personil yang terlatih untuk mengelola dan menjaga sistem DBMS dengan benar. Pelatihan dan pengembangan staf dapat menambah biaya dan waktu yang diperlukan.
3. Memerlukan Perangkat Keras yang Memadai
DBMS yang efisien memerlukan perangkat keras yang kuat. Ini termasuk server, penyimpanan, dan jaringan yang memadai. Investasi dalam infrastruktur ini dapat menjadi mahal, terutama jika perusahaan ingin memastikan kinerja yang optimal.
4. Rawan terhadap Serangan Hacker
Karena DBMS berisi data yang sangat berharga, sistem ini seringkali menjadi sasaran empuk bagi peretas. Keamanan DBMS sangat penting, dan jika tidak dikelola dengan baik, data dapat rentan terhadap serangan hacker.
Perusahaan harus mengambil langkah-langkah keamanan yang serius, seperti enkripsi data dan pemantauan keamanan yang konstan.
5. Memerlukan Pemeliharaan yang Teratur
DBMS memerlukan pemeliharaan yang teratur, termasuk backup data, pemulihan data, pemantauan kinerja, dan pembaruan perangkat lunak. Jika pemeliharaan ini diabaikan, dapat menyebabkan kegagalan sistem dan hilangnya data yang berharga.
Baca juga: Cloud Database vs Traditional Database: Migrasi untuk Kesuksesan Bisnis Modern
Contoh Penerapan DBMS
Database Management System (DBMS) memiliki berbagai penerapan yang luas di berbagai sektor. Berikut adalah beberapa contoh penerapan DBMS yang relevan:
1. DBMS dalam Sistem Perbankan
Sistem perbankan adalah salah satu contoh penerapan utama DBMS. Bank mengelola berbagai jenis data, seperti informasi pelanggan, transaksi, rekening, dan sejarah kredit. DBMS digunakan untuk menyimpan, mengelola, dan mengakses data ini dengan aman.
Bank dapat dengan mudah melacak transaksi pelanggan, menghasilkan laporan keuangan, dan mengelola rekening dengan efisien. Penggunaan DBMS juga memungkinkan bank untuk memberikan layanan perbankan online kepada pelanggan dengan akses data yang cepat dan aman.
2. DBMS dalam Toko Online
Toko online mengandalkan DBMS untuk mengelola berbagai informasi, seperti katalog produk, stok, pesanan, dan informasi pelanggan. DBMS memungkinkan toko online untuk menyimpan dan memperbarui data produk dengan mudah, mengelola pesanan pelanggan, dan melacak inventaris.
Ini membuat pengelolaan toko online menjadi lebih efisien dan memungkinkan pelanggan untuk mengakses informasi produk yang akurat dan up-to-date.
3. DBMS dalam Bidang Pendidikan
Di bidang pendidikan, DBMS digunakan dalam berbagai cara. Sekolah dan perguruan tinggi menggunakan DBMS untuk mengelola data siswa, jadwal pelajaran, dan catatan akademik.
Guru dapat dengan mudah mengakses informasi tentang perkembangan siswa, dan lembaga pendidikan dapat menghasilkan laporan yang berguna. DBMS juga digunakan dalam penerimaan siswa, pendaftaran, dan pengelolaan perpustakaan sekolah.
4. DBMS dalam Sistem Manajemen Perpustakaan
DBMS juga digunakan dalam sistem manajemen perpustakaan. Perpustakaan menyimpan data tentang koleksi buku, peminjaman, anggota perpustakaan, dan lainnya.
Bantuan dari DBMS memungkinkan perpustakaan dapat mengelola katalog buku dengan efisien, melacak peminjaman, dan mengelola anggota perpustakaan. Ini memungkinkan perpustakaan untuk memberikan layanan yang lebih baik kepada pengunjung.
5. DBMS di Bidang Manufaktur
Sektor manufaktur juga mengambil manfaat dari DBMS. Sistem ini digunakan untuk mengelola data produksi, persediaan, dan rantai pasokan. Perusahaan manufaktur dapat merencanakan produksi dengan lebih baik, mengoptimalkan proses produksi, dan mengendalikan inventaris dengan lebih efisien.
DBMS juga memungkinkan perusahaan untuk melacak perkembangan produk selama proses manufaktur dan menghasilkan laporan kualitas.
Baca juga: Migrasi Database: Pengertian, Jenis dan Tujuannya
Tips Mengoptimalkan Penggunaan DBMS
Selain memahami contoh penerapan DBMS, penting juga untuk mengoptimalkan penggunaan DBMS di dalam perusahaan. Berikut adalah beberapa tips yang dapat membantu:
1. Memilih DBMS yang Sesuai dengan Kebutuhan
Pertama-tama, pilih DBMS yang sesuai dengan kebutuhan bisnis Anda. Setiap DBMS memiliki fitur yang berbeda, dan pemilihan yang tepat dapat membuat perbedaan besar dalam efisiensi dan produktivitas.
Pastikan DBMS yang Anda pilih cocok dengan skala bisnis Anda, jenis data yang Anda kelola, dan anggaran yang tersedia.
2. Memastikan Keamanan Data
Keamanan data adalah prioritas utama. Pastikan Anda mengimplementasikan langkah-langkah keamanan yang diperlukan, seperti pengaturan hak akses yang tepat, enkripsi data, dan pemantauan keamanan yang konstan. Ini akan melindungi data sensitif dan mengurangi risiko terhadap serangan hacker.
3. Melakukan Backup Data secara Teratur
Selalu lakukan pencadangan data secara teratur. Ini merupakan langkah penting dalam menghadapi kehilangan data akibat kegagalan sistem, kesalahan manusia, atau serangan siber. Pastikan data cadangan disimpan di lokasi yang aman.
4. Memperbarui Perangkat Lunak DBMS secara Berkala
Pastikan Anda selalu menggunakan versi perangkat lunak DBMS yang terbaru. Pembaruan tersebut seringkali mencakup perbaikan keamanan, peningkatan kinerja, dan perbaikan bug. Perangkat lunak DBMS yang terjaga dengan baik dan tetap update memungkinkan Anda dapat mengurangi risiko kerentanannya terhadap serangan dan masalah teknis.
5. Melakukan Tuning Database untuk Meningkatkan Performa
Dalam jangka panjang, perlu memantau dan mengoptimalkan kinerja basis data. Tuning database melibatkan pengaturan ulang dan penyesuaian agar performa sistem tetap optimal. Ini melibatkan pemantauan beban kerja basis data, indeks yang tepat, dan peningkatan kueri SQL.
Dalam mengimplementasikan DBMS, kita harus mempertimbangkan kebutuhan bisnis dan mengikuti praktik terbaik dalam mengoptimalkan penggunaan DBMS. Hal ini memungkinkan kita dapat memanfaatkan kelebihan DBMS sambil meminimalkan risiko yang terkait.
Sebagai pemilik bisnis, Anda harus mempertimbangkan Deka Box dari Cloudeka sebagai Cloud Storage Service Providers terkemuka yang bisa menjadi pilihan terbaik dalam pengelolaan data. Melalui Deka Box, Cloudeka menawarkan solusi pengelolaan database yang komprehensif yang dirancang untuk menyederhanakan pengelolaan data bisnis Anda.
Fitur-fitur keamanan yang kuat, efisiensi tinggi, dan dukungan yang andal membuat Deka Box menjadi pilihan yang bijak untuk membantu bisnis Anda berkembang.
Jika Anda tertarik dengan produk ini, segera hubungi kami untuk informasi lebih lanjut mengenai produk ini. Jangan lupa untuk menjelajahi solusi digital lain yang kami tawarkan sistem Anda lebih optimal dan memastikan kelangsungan bisnis yang sukses.
Tingkatkan kualitas pengelolaan dan pengamanan data penting bisnis Anda sekarang juga bersama Cloudeka!